The BOA1004P by ThorLabs is an exceptional booster optical amplifier that is optimized for applications with known input polarization of light. It is ideal for both monochromatic and multi-wavelength signals. Compared to traditional SOA devices, the BOA1004P boasts superior bandwidth, gain, noise, and saturation power specifications due to its sensitive polarization design features.
With high saturation output power and bandwidth, the BOA1004P incorporates an efficient InP/InGaAsP Quantum Well (QW) layer structure and a reliable ridge waveguide design. It is housed in a14-pin butterfly package that are standardized with an integrated thermoelectric cooler (TEC) and thermistor, making it suitable for a wide range of applications. Any PM-fiber pigtails that have FC/APC connectors will be compatible with this device, and the key of the connector will always be aligned to the slow axis on all models with PM-fiber pigtails. The BOA1004P is also compatible with optional polarization-maintaining isolators at either the output or input or both the output and input.
The BOA1004P offers low coupling losses, as well as free-space chips offered on submount or heatsink. Losses typically range from 1.5 to 2.5 dB for the fiber-to-chip and chip-to-fiber coupling (each). These losses have an impact on the device's total gain, noise figure (NF), and saturation power (Psat), even though the amplifier's gain exceeds the losses. Hence, these losses remain a crucial factor in determining the device's performance.
Operating Current | 600 mA Typical |
Central Wavelength | 1550 nm Typical |
Polarization Extinction Ratio | 18 dB Typical |
Noise Figure | 7.5 dB Typical |
Forward Voltage | 1.3 V Typical |
TEC Current | 0.13 A Typical |
TEC Voltage | 0.28 V Typical |
Thermistor Resistance | 10 kΩ Typical |
